About

In the years before J S Bach embarked upon his Suites for unaccompanied cello, the form was being honed to perfection by composers of the many suites for solo bass viol written in France between 1650 and 1700.

Renowned viol player, and founder director of London Baroque, Charles Medlam performs a number of works by Nicolas Hotman, Dubuisson, DeMachy and the mysterious Sieur de Sainte-Colombe, charting the evolution of the classical suite.

A fascinating exploration of beautiful and rarely-heard repertoire.
